NASA's Viking missions to Mars in the 1970s showed the martian soil to be disappointingly lifeless and depleted in organic materials, the chemical precursors necessary for life. Webatacama rover helps nasa learn to search for life on mars-- A dedicated team of scientists spent four weeks in 2004 in northern Chile's Atacama Desert. They studied the scarce life that exists there and, in the process, helped NASA learn more about how primitive life forms could exist on Mars. . . halys tenista

Even when the planet … halz jacksonville ncWebHow can you study Mars without a spaceship? Head to the most Martian place on Earth -- the Atacama Desert in Chile. Astrobiologist Armando Azua-Bustos grew up in this vast, arid landscape and now studies the rare life forms that have adapted to survive there, some in areas with no reported rainfall for the past 400 years.
